Assignment Brief
Scenario: You have completed the investigation into the information systems when Jim Coffee (the
firms chief construction executive and a member of the senior leadership team) says that following the
excitement generated at Board level by your previous management report he wants you to prepare
another management report for the senior leadership teams next meeting. Some members of the
senior leadership team have expressed interest in understanding more detail about particular
information systems.
Write a management report of around 2000 words explaining (with reference to the course
brief): (a) the business value proposition for the selected information system, (b) a detailed
explanation of the information systems features and functions and how they align to the
firms business functional areas/operations, and (c) how the information system will assist
the firms project managers in managing projects.

Remember the audience is the senior (executive) leadership team who are NOT technology literate so
you should use appropriate business language and refrain from using project management,
construction, or technical jargon.
